In 1989 Sylvia Murphy and David Greenland set off to sail around the world on their 60 year old Maurice Griffiths' ketch, Nyala. While they were in Portugal they adopted one of the many lost, sickly kittens that haunt the harbours of Southern Europe. They called her Tyfoon, after the Belgian boat that first rescued her. This is the true story of how Tyfoon took over and re-organised the direction of their lives for the next eighteen years. It is a mixture of comedy and disaster, courage and love, that pulls at the heartstrings.
